Understanding Dolby Atmos: The Global Standard for Immersive Sound

Dolby Atmos is a groundbreaking audio technology that has transformed the way we listen to movies, music, and games. Unlike traditional surround sound systems, which rely on a fixed number of speakers placed around the room, Dolby Atmos uses object-based audio to create a three-dimensional soundscape. This means that sounds can be precisely positioned and moved throughout the space, giving listeners an incredibly realistic and engaging audio experience.

Atmos supports up to 128 audio objects, each with its own unique path through the room. This level of detail allows for incredibly nuanced sound effects, such as raindrops falling from above or footsteps moving across the floor. The technology is widely adopted in theaters and has been integrated into numerous home theater systems, making it the go-to choice for audiophiles and casual viewers alike.
